Brown University, based in Providence, Rhode Island offers a fully funded PhD in French and Francophone Studies. The Graduate Program in French and Francophone Studies offers a lively intellectual environment where students explore French and Francophone literature and cultures across a broad chronological and topical range and through a wide variety of critical approaches. Students in the PhD program are guaranteed a competitive package of six years of academic year funding. and four summers of financial support with full tuition remission and health and dental insurance coverage. Students are also guaranteed funding each year for conference travel or other research needs.
